Eve Rifkah was co-founder of Poetry Oasis, Inc. (1998-2012), a non-profit poetry association dedicated to education and promoting local poets. She was the founder and editor of Diner, a literary magazine, and earned her MFA from Vermont College. She also teaches poetry with the WISE program at Assumption University. Rifkah is the author of Dear Suzanne (WordTech Communications, 2010) and Outcasts: The Penikese Island Leper Hospital 1905-1921 (Little Pear Press 2010). Her next book Lost in Sight, will be coming out in 2021 from Silver Bow Publishing. Rifkah has published two chapbooks: “Scar Tissue” (Finishing Line Press, 2017), and “At the Leprosarium,” 2003 winner of the Revelever Chapbook Contest. Her single poems, flash fiction stories, and essays have appeared in many journals.
